一、vue源码如何调试?
要调试Vue源码,可以按照以下步骤进行操作:
1. 在Vue项目中安装Vue Devtools插件,它可以帮助你调试Vue应用程序。
2. 在Vue源码中添加断点,可以使用Chrome浏览器的开发者工具或其他调试工具。
3. 在Vue项目中使用sourcemap,这样可以在调试时将编译后的代码映射回源代码。
4. 使用console.log()在Vue源码中输出调试信息,以便了解代码执行过程中的变量值和状态。
5. 阅读Vue源码的文档和注释,以便更好地理解代码的逻辑和功能。
6. 参考Vue官方文档和社区资源,了解常见的调试技巧和问题解决方法。
通过这些方法,你可以更好地理解和调试Vue源码,以便解决问题和优化应用程序。
二、如何高效阅读大数据组件源码?
先用一些UML工具根据源码生成UML,先看UML图,对程序类的组成和关联情况有个大致的印象,然后再看代码,这样就会容易一些。
三、如何修改linux内核源码并调试?
要修改和调试Linux内核源码,首先需要下载适当版本的源码,然后进行修改并编译成可执行内核。可以使用调试器和日志工具来跟踪代码执行和定位问题。
建议在虚拟机或者开发板上运行修改后的内核,通过调试工具如gdb或者printk输出来进行调试。
要注意保留原始代码,使用版本控制工具管理修改,并参考Linux内核开发者手册和相关社区资源进行学习和解决问题。
四、大数据项目源码
大数据项目源码概述
在当今数字化时代,大数据项目已经成为许多企业关注的焦点。随着数据规模的不断增长,企业越来越意识到利用大数据技术来获取洞察和优化决策的重要性。本文将探讨大数据项目源码的重要性以及如何有效地管理和利用这些源码。
大数据项目的关键组成部分
大数据项目通常包括数据采集、数据存储、数据处理和数据可视化等环节。在这些环节中,源码起着至关重要的作用。大数据项目源码是实现数据处理和分析功能的核心。通过编写高效和可靠的源码,开发人员可以实现数据的清洗、转换、分析和展示,从而为企业决策提供支持。
大数据项目源码通常涉及多种技术栈,如Hadoop、Spark、Kafka等。这些技术的源码不仅包含了基本的数据处理逻辑,还涉及了并行计算、数据分区、容错处理等复杂的技术细节。只有深入理解这些源码,开发人员才能更好地应用这些技术解决实际业务问题。
源码管理与版本控制
对于大数据项目源码的管理十分关键。源码管理系统可以帮助开发团队有效地共享、合作和追踪源码的变更。在大数据项目中,由于涉及的组件较多,不同团队协作开发,因此需要一个强大的版本控制系统来管理源码的版本和变更历史。
常见的源码管理工具如Git和SVN等,都提供了强大的分支管理、合并和代码审查功能,有助于团队保持源码的整洁和规范。通过良好的源码管理实践,团队可以更好地协作开发,提高代码质量和项目交付效率。
源码质量与审查
保证大数据项目源码的质量是开发过程中的重要任务之一。优质的源码应具备清晰的逻辑结构、高效的算法设计和完善的异常处理机制。为了确保源码质量,开发团队可以进行代码审查和静态代码分析。
代码审查是指开发人员相互审阅源码,发现潜在的问题和改进空间。通过代码审查,团队可以及时发现和解决源码中的bug,减少后续维护成本。静态代码分析工具如SonarQube等可以帮助开发团队找出潜在的编码问题,提高源码的质量和稳定性。
源码文档与知识分享
在大数据项目中,源码文档对于项目的可维护性和可扩展性至关重要。良好的源码文档应该包括源码结构、函数用途、参数说明、返回值定义等关键信息。通过编写清晰详细的文档,团队成员可以更快地理解和使用源码。
另外,知识分享也是源码管理的重要环节。开发团队可以通过内部培训、技术分享会等形式,传播源码设计思想、调优经验和最佳实践。这有助于团队成员共同提高技术水平,推动项目的持续发展。
结语
大数据项目源码是实现数据处理和分析功能的关键,对于企业的发展至关重要。有效地管理和利用源码可以提高团队的开发效率和项目的质量。希望本文能帮助读者更好地理解大数据项目源码的重要性,促进大数据技术在企业中的应用和发展。
五、dt大数据营销系统源码
在当今数字化时代,大数据营销系统源码的重要性越来越被企业所重视。随着互联网的普及和数据技术的不断发展,利用数据来推动营销已经成为了企业获取竞争优势的重要手段之一。大数据营销系统源码作为支撑整个大数据营销系统的基础,具有至关重要的作用。
什么是大数据营销系统源码?
大数据营销系统源码是指用于构建大数据营销系统的代码和程序。它包含了数据采集、数据处理、数据分析、营销策略执行等功能模块的源代码。
通过定制、开发和优化大数据营销系统源码,企业可以根据自身的需求,构建适合自己业务特点和发展阶段的大数据营销系统。
为什么需要定制大数据营销系统源码?
企业之所以需要定制大数据营销系统源码,主要有以下几个原因:
- 满足个性化需求:根据企业的具体需求和发展阶段,定制化的大数据营销系统源码可以更好地满足企业个性化的营销需求。
- 提升系统性能:定制化开发的系统源码可以更好地优化系统性能,提升数据处理和分析效率。
- 强化数据安全:通过对系统源码的定制开发,可以加强数据安全机制,保护企业重要数据不受泄露和攻击。
如何选择适合的大数据营销系统源码?
在选择大数据营销系统源码时,企业需要考虑以下几个因素:
- 功能完善性:系统源码是否包含了企业所需的全部功能模块,是否支持数据采集、处理、分析、执行等环节。
- 定制化程度:系统源码是否支持二次开发和定制化,以满足企业个性化需求。
- 技术支持:选择具有良好技术支持和售后服务的大数据营销系统源码供应商,可以确保系统稳定运行。
大数据营销系统源码的未来发展趋势
大数据营销系统源码在未来的发展中将呈现以下几个趋势:
- 智能化:未来的大数据营销系统源码将更加智能化,通过人工智能和机器学习技术,实现数据分析和营销策略的智能化优化。
- 跨平台性:未来的大数据营销系统源码将注重跨平台性,支持多设备、多渠道的数据采集和分析,以满足多样化的营销需求。
- 安全性:未来的大数据营销系统源码将进一步强化数据安全机制,保护企业重要数据不受任何威胁。
结语
大数据营销系统源码作为现代营销领域的重要组成部分,对于企业提升营销效果、实现竞争优势具有重要意义。定制化开发适合企业自身需求的大数据营销系统源码,将有助于企业实现数字化转型,迎接未来的挑战。
六、大数据后台分析系统源码
大数据后台分析系统源码
大数据技术是近年来互联网行业的热门话题之一,随着互联网用户数量的不断增加和各种智能设备的普及,数据量呈现爆炸式增长的态势。在这样的背景下,大数据分析就显得尤为重要,它可以帮助企业从海量数据中挖掘出有价值的信息,为决策提供科学依据。
大数据后台分析系统是支撑大数据处理和分析的重要环节,它通过收集、存储、处理和展示数据,为用户提供全面的数据分析服务。对于开发人员来说,了解大数据后台分析系统的源码具有重要的意义,可以帮助他们更好地理解系统的运作原理,优化系统性能,甚至进行定制开发。
下面我们就来分享一份关于大数据后台分析系统源码的介绍,希望对大家有所帮助。
什么是大数据后台分析系统源码?
大数据后台分析系统源码是指用于构建大数据处理和分析系统的代码资源。这些源码通常包括数据采集、数据存储、数据处理、数据展示等功能模块的实现代码,开发人员可以在此基础上进行二次开发,根据实际需求进行定制。
大数据后台分析系统源码的价值在于帮助开发人员快速搭建起一个可靠高效的大数据处理平台,提升数据处理和分析的效率,从而更好地为企业决策提供支持。
为什么要了解大数据后台分析系统源码?
了解大数据后台分析系统源码可以带来诸多好处,包括:
- 深入理解系统原理:通过阅读源码,可以更深入地了解大数据处理和分析系统的工作原理,帮助开发人员掌握核心技术。
- 优化系统性能:熟悉源码结构和算法设计,可以帮助开发人员发现系统中的性能瓶颈,进而进行针对性优化。
- 定制开发:在现有源码基础上进行二次开发,根据企业需求定制各种功能模块,提升系统的适用性和灵活性。
如何学习大数据后台分析系统源码?
学习大数据后台分析系统源码需要具备一定的编程基础和对大数据技术的了解。以下是学习源码的一些建议:
- 阅读官方文档:大多数开源项目会提供详细的官方文档,介绍系统的架构设计、核心功能和使用方法,是学习源码的重要参考资料。
- 参与社区讨论:加入开源项目的社区,参与讨论和交流,可以与其他开发者互动,分享经验,解决问题。
- 实践操作:通过动手实践,将源码部署在本地环境中,运行调试,深入了解每个模块的实现方式和调用关系。
- 阅读源码:逐行阅读源码,理解每个函数和类的作用,分析代码逻辑,掌握系统的整体结构和运行流程。
结语
大数据后台分析系统源码是学习大数据技术、提升技术水平的重要资源,在掌握源码的基础上,开发人员可以更好地应用大数据技术,为企业创造更大的价值。希望以上内容对大家有所帮助,欢迎大家分享交流!
七、大数据机器学习项目源码
随着互联网的快速发展,大数据和机器学习技术越来越受到关注。在当今数字化时代,大数据机器学习项目源码成为了许多企业和研究机构的重要资产。这些源码不仅可以帮助人们更好地理解和应用机器学习算法,还可以加快项目的开发和部署速度。
大数据机器学习项目源码的重要性
大数据机器学习项目源码是指一套可执行的代码,其中实现了各种机器学习算法、数据处理技术和模型训练方法。这些源码通常包含了数据预处理、特征工程、模型建立、训练和评估等步骤,能够帮助开发人员快速搭建机器学习系统。
对于开发者而言,获取优质的大数据机器学习项目源码意味着可以节省大量研发时间,快速验证想法,并加速产品上线。同时,通过学习和参考开源项目,开发者可以积累更多的经验和技能,提升自己在机器学习领域的竞争力。
如何找到优质的大数据机器学习项目源码
要想找到优质的大数据机器学习项目源码并非易事,需要综合考虑多个方面的因素。以下是一些寻找优质源码的方法和建议:
- GitHub搜索:GitHub是全球最大的开源项目托管平台,您可以通过搜索关键词找到数以千计的机器学习项目源码。
- 开发者社区:参与机器学习开发者社区的讨论和交流,可以获得其他开发者推荐的优秀项目源码。
- 学术论文:阅读相关领域的学术论文,作者通常会公开他们的研究代码和数据集。
- 在线资源:一些在线平台如Kaggle、TensorFlow等提供了丰富的机器学习示例和源码。
如何利用大数据机器学习项目源码
一旦找到了符合需求的大数据机器学习项目源码,接下来就是如何正确地利用这些源码。以下是一些建议:
- 理解源码:首先要深入理解源码中所涉及的算法原理和实现细节,这样才能更好地应用到自己的项目中。
- 修改定制:根据自身需求对源码进行修改和定制,以适应特定的业务场景和数据集。
- 调试测试:在使用源码前要充分测试和调试,确保算法的正确性和稳定性。
- 持续学习:机器学习领域日新月异,持续学习新的算法和技术,保持自己的竞争力。
结语
大数据机器学习项目源码对于促进机器学习技术的发展和应用具有重要意义。开发者们应当积极利用开源项目,不断学习和实践,将机器学习技术应用到更多的实际场景中。
八、怎么调试基于大数据分析的的系统?
调试基于大数据分析的系统需要注意以下几点:
首先,要对数据进行清洗和预处理,确保数据质量和一致性;
其次,要选择合适的算法和模型,并进行优化和调整,以提高分析的准确性和效率;另外,要注重系统的可扩展性和稳定性,确保在处理大量数据时不会出现崩溃或性能下降等问题。
最后,要进行全面的测试和验证,确保系统能够满足用户需求和预期效果。
九、想研读下spark的源码,怎么搭阅读和调试的环境?
考虑到eclipse对Scala糟糕的支持,真的不建议使用eclipse搭建源码阅读环境,推荐IDEA。方法1、直接用sbt编译并生成idea工程文件导入IDEA。方法2、直接用IDEA导入git工程,利用IDEA的sbt插件自动编译。用上面两张种方式编译应该是最简便的方法了。网络通畅的话不用等很久,我在Mac下编译spark1.6连下载一共也就花了一个小时左右的时间。真要用eclipse也不是不可以,可以尝试用sbt先编译好了再做为Scala项目导入eclipse中。
十、深入探索大数据项目:获取完整源码与实践指南
在当今信息技术飞速发展的时代,大数据作为一种新兴的技术趋势,已成为各行各业探索商业价值的重要工具。从数据采集、存储到分析与可视化,大数据项目的实现需要经历一系列复杂而专业的步骤。本篇文章将为您提供关于大数据完整项目源码的深入探讨,以及如何有效地利用这些源码来推动您的项目实践。
1. 什么是大数据项目
大数据项目是指利用大量、高速、多样化的数据进行处理与分析的过程,旨在从中提取有价值的信息和洞察力。这些项目通常涉及以下几个方面:
- 数据采集:通过各种方式收集数据,包括传感器、日志、社交媒体等。
- 数据存储:采用分布式数据库、云存储等技术进行高效的数据存储。
- 数据处理:利用大数据处理框架(如Hadoop或Spark)进行数据分析和处理。
- 数据可视化:将分析结果通过可视化工具展示,帮助用户更好地理解数据。
2. 大数据项目源码的重要性
获取完整的项目源码对于希望学习和实践大数据的开发者而言至关重要。源码不仅可以帮助您理解项目的整体架构,还能让您更深入地学习具体的技术实现。此外,源码通常还包含一些典型的用例和最佳实践,以下是获取源码的几大好处:
- 提高学习效率:有了实际的源码,您可以更快地掌握复杂的技术概念和实现方式。
- 实践机会:通过动手操作源码,您能够培养实践技能,更好地理解理论知识。
- 社区支持:众多开源项目通常伴随着活跃的社区支持,可以帮助您解决在实践中遇到的问题。
3. 获取大数据完整项目源码的途径
获取大数据项目的完整源码可以通过多种途径,这里列出一些常见的来源:
- GitHub:作为全球最大的代码托管平台,GitHub上有大量的开源大数据项目,您可以通过搜索关键字找到相关项目。
- 开源社区:如Apache、Cloudera等,这些社区提供许多用于大数据的框架和工具的源码,便于学习和开发。
- 专业书籍:一些与大数据相关的书籍会附带项目源码,帮助读者理解书中的案例和理念。
- 在线教育平台:一些在线平台如Coursera、Udacity等提供课程时,往往也会分享项目源码供学习使用。
4. 如何有效使用大数据项目源码
获得大数据项目源码后,要想充分发挥其价值,您需要遵循一些最佳实践:
- 深入阅读文档:很多开源项目会附带详细的文档,了解项目结构与代码逻辑是熟悉源码的第一步。
- 设置测试环境:在本地搭建适合的环境,包括数据库、计算框架等,以便进行测试和调试。
- 修改与扩展:在理解原始代码的基础上,尝试修改或扩展功能,能够加深对代码的理解。
- 参与社区互动:加入项目的社区,参与讨论或提交问题,可以让您获得更多的指导和建议。
5. 示例项目:使用Apache Spark进行数据分析
作为一个流行的大数据处理框架,Apache Spark有许多开源项目可供学习。以下是一些典型的项目示例:
- Spark Streaming示例:实时处理数据流的演示,适合学习如何处理实时数据。
- MLlib示例:机器学习库的示例代码,帮助了解如何应用机器学习算法进行数据分析。
- GraphX示例:图计算框架的项目,适合对社交网络分析等领域有兴趣的开发者。
6. 注意事项和挑战
在使用大数据项目源码时,您可能会面临一些挑战,了解这些挑战有助于提前做好准备:
- 技术复杂性:大数据项目常涉及多种技术栈,初学者可能在某些技术上遇到障碍。
- 环境配置:大数据项目需要特定的环境与配置,搭建过程可能比较繁琐。
- 更新频繁:开源项目通常频繁更新,需要跟上版本的变化和更新文档。
结尾
在大数据领域,源码是学习与实践的重要工具,通过深入研究和实践这些源码,您将能有效提升自己的技术水平,把握行业发展趋势。希望本文能够为您在大数据项目的探索旅程中提供有效的指导和帮助。
感谢您阅读这篇文章,希望您能从中获得启发,通过大数据项目源码的学习与实践,为您的职业发展添砖加瓦。